Transportation to dialysis

My husband needs transportation to dialysis Monday,Wednesday and Friday from Bonham, Texas to Sherman,Texas we have exhausted all avenues given to us saying that they don’t service our area. Anyone out there have any suggestions. We have contacted our insurance carrier (Comfort Care), Taps, Uber, Lyft, Taxi

If you haven't found anything yet, consider:

  1. The Non-emergency medication transportation program run by the State's Health and Human Services. The program is open to people with an annual income of $60k or less and I think it requires Medicaid eligibility even for Medicare recipients. It appears individuals can apply to be drivers under this program. 877-633-8747 is the number given on the HHS website.
  2. Texoma Area on Aging Agency at 800-677-8264 (903-813-3505) or info@texoma.cog.tx.us
  3. Start at the national level and contact resources under the National Kidney Foundation (www.kidney.org/patients/resources), your dialysis provider, or the American Association of Kidney Patients (www.aakp.org
  4. Last resort, look into home dialysis.
